Classic Ham Loaf Recipe

Ingredients:
1 lb. ground ham
1/2 lb. ground fresh pork
1/2 cup soft bread crumbs
1/2 cup water
2 tablespoons instant minced onion
1/4 teaspoon pepper
Preparation Method:
Mix ground ham and pork thoroughly with crumbs, water, onion, and pepper. Mold into flat oval loaf in 10×6x2-in. dish, or flat loaf in 9-in. pie plate.
Insert temperature probe so tip is in center of food. Cover tightly with plastic wrap, arranging loosely around probe to vent. Attach cable end at receptacle. Microwave at medium. Set Temp, Set 170 degree.
When oven signals, remove loaf from oven and let stand 5 minutes before serving. Makes 6 servings.
On models not equipped with probe use minimum microwave time and check for doneness.
Note:
1. If a fast simple glaze is desired, spoon pineapple or apricot preserves over cooked ham loaf a few minutes before serving.
2. For best cooking results, do not exceed recommended weight of meat.
